At the beginning of the semester I told the players that at mid-semester if the grades weren't good then there were going to be punishments. There's no reason for this to happen. We have study hall twice a week and a free tutoring service. I think a lot of the guys took it lightly and they got surprised.

We have 30 guys, so we have to spread the money out. Losing 1.7 scholarships doesn't affect just one or two people; we're talking about five or maybe six guys. We can't put the program in a position where we get penalized year in and year out with 1.7 scholarships because we're not taking care of our academics.
